Retired FBI criminal profiler and bestselling author Candice DeLong is an internationally recognized homicide expert, news commentator, and host of documentary TV series and podcasts. She was recruited by the FBI while serving as Head Nurse at the Institute of Psychiatry in Chicago - Northwestern University Hospital and her career as a psychiatric nurse sets her apart from other crime analysts or FBI profilers in that she can present a clinical perspective on violent crime. She spent 20 years on the front lines of many high-profile FBI cases, including the Chicago Tylenol Murders and the Unabomber. Candice is a frequent guest on CNN and Dr. Phil, as well as countless other news programs. Additionally, she created and hosted programs including
CRIME TIME with Candice DeLong, a Cumulus radio show, and
FACING EVIL with Candice DeLong, a prison interview series on Investigation Discovery. Candice is also the face of ID’s long-running series
DEADLY WOMEN, now seen in 135 countries. Her bestselling memoir
SPECIAL AGENT: My Life on the Front Lines as a Woman in the FBI, was the first career memoir to be written by a female agent. Candice hosts two podcasts, Killer Psyche Headlines and created the award-winning
Killer Psyche with Candice DeLong which launched its third season in September 2023. Her latest podcast series is the twisted true crime documentary entitled
Natural Selection: Scott v Wild Bill.
